Output 3c3dd37689656cfce4f5d6da4d729f4b73bcc5c168e52341b587d5fcac9be326:1

value
2685494
script pubkey
OP_0 OP_PUSHBYTES_32 17c90bb5c3e793fbd723e2834f60fb0709d1b26f8c6e9b097578b5adcf5d4a03
address
bc1qzlyshdwru7flh4eru2p57c8mquyarvn033hfkzt40z66mn6afgps5e5xkg
transaction
3c3dd37689656cfce4f5d6da4d729f4b73bcc5c168e52341b587d5fcac9be326